Tips Before You Lease Your BMW
- Compare Total Lease Costs: Look beyond monthly payments—review total lease amount, mileage fees, and residual value estimates.
- Inquire About Hybrid and Electric Models: Carbon-credit-aided leases for BMW i models often provide the biggest discounts.
- Negotiate Flexible Mileage: Avoid overage fees with planned mileage usage and clearups built into the lease.
- Use Lease Comparison Tools: Websites like Edmunds, Kelley Blue Book, and Parkers offer detailed lease calculators and current incentives.
